About this tool

Create an editable Word document from embedded PDF text while keeping source-page boundaries traceable.

Open XML packaging makes the output a genuine DOCX rather than renamed plain text.

Text order follows the PDF content stream and can require editing for multi-column layouts.

Frequently asked questions

Is the result a real DOCX file?

Yes. The download is an Open XML Word document package that compatible word processors can open and edit.

Does it preserve the original layout?

No. It preserves extracted text by source page and inserts page breaks, but does not recreate columns, fonts, images, or positioned elements.

Will scanned PDFs convert?

Image-only scans need OCR first and may otherwise create page placeholders with no extracted text.
